Just nicely got home from this year's Atomic Festival, held at Sywell Aerodrome in Northants. We went with Carol and Jon and took the Tin shed with the caddy. I have to say it was the best event I've ever been to, everything was just right; Awesome Art Deco aerodrome setting including a really atmospheric hangar for the dances Amazing bands all weekend Great cars Great vintage caravans and motorhomes A drive in movie on Saturday night Brilliant air displays ( Look up Pitts Special G-EWIZ, the pilot is a hooligan!) Gassers, VHRA flag start drag racing, vintage stock car racing Food vendors selling nice grub from vintage vehicles The list goes on. All I can say is, if you are sick of car shows always being the same and you like a bit of nostalgia, book it for next year! Here are a few pics
